Increased collaboration can help public sector teams:

  • Work more efficiently within the constraints of limited budgets
  • Deliver better government services

But collaborating across departments can be difficult, and the rise of remote work has further complicated cross-team and inner-team collaboration.

Modern software tools can help governments simplify cross-agency collaboration and project management through centralized information hubs. With these tools, organizations can easily collaborate, communicate and track the progress of teams large and small, across all work.

Learn how agencies can harness these highly effective collaboration practices and tools to work better together during a webinar hosted by Government Technology on March 29, 2023, at 11am PT/2pm ET.

As a participant in this webinar, you’ll learn:

  • Tips and techniques for creating a highly productive distributed work environment
  • How to simplify hybrid workflows
  • How to handle new project management workflows during transformation initiatives

Mark Cruth

Modern Work Coach, Atlassian

Mark Cruth is Atlassian’s resident Modern Work Expert. Focused on practice over theory, Mark spends his days coaching both Atlassian and customer teams on new ways of working, then sharing what he’s learned at events around the world. Joining Atlassian in 2019, Mark brings over a decade of experience experimenting with work and helping people, teams, and organizations transform at places like Boeing, Nordstrom, TD Ameritrade, and Rocket Mortgage. Mark has made it his mission to inject modern ways of working, a transformation mindset, and the power of expert storytelling into everything he does.

William (Bill) Rials, Ph.D — Moderator

Senior Fellow, Center for Digital Government

William (Bill) Rials, Ph.D., is a professor and associate director (department chair) of the Tulane University School of Professional Advancement IT and Cybersecurity Program. He focuses on continually delivering and updating the program curriculum based on innovative and emerging technologies. Before transitioning to academia and higher education, he had a diverse gov tech career delivering value to state agencies, local governments, and law enforcement agencies throughout the state of Mississippi.
